The project provides key insights into corporate sustainability shaped by legal, financial, and technological dimensions. It highlights how ethical considerations in supply chain management influence corporate responsibilities and emphasizes the role of transparency and accountability. The research also explores environmental governance within companies, focusing on effective sustainable practices and disclosure.
On corporate governance, the study examines shareholder activism and stakeholder capitalism, analyzing the impact of technology governance on corporate strategies. Additionally, it evaluates the balance between regulatory costs and benefits, proposing legal frameworks that support sustainable development without overburdening businesses.
This research advances the discourse on sustainable corporate governance by offering actionable insights for policymakers and corporate leaders, helping them craft more effective sustainability strategies.
